The scientific name of the plant from which Brahmi powder is derived is "Bacopa monnier i" a perennial plant that inhabits the humid areas of southern and eastern India, Australia, Europe, Africa, Asia, North and South America.
“Bacopa monnieri” has been used since ancient times as a medicinal herb in traditional Indian medicine, Ayurveda.

Brahmi for hair
Brahmi powder and Ayurvedic is perfect for taking care of the health and beauty of hair : it strengthens the roots and the shaft, helps prevent and treat scalp problems such as dermatitis and the appearance of dandruff.

Mix 2-3 tablespoons with warm water until you get a smooth mixture and let it rest for 15/20 minutes.
Apply the cream obtained on dry hair , distributing from the roots to the ends passing through the lengths and massaging the scalp with large circular movements. Leave on for at least 1 hour and finally rinse
Apply pure on greasy hair and with the addition of jojoba oil on dry hair.
Brahmi powder can also be used in combination with other Ayurvedic herbs, to combine properties and benefits:
- With neem : the anti-dandruff effect is enhanced
- With amla : the strengthening effect is intensified
- With shikakai : wash your hair with an alternative shampoo and at the same time take advantage of the properties of Brahmi. The dose is 1:1
Brahmi for skin
It has a positive effect on skin problems and has a healing effect on the epidermal tissue . It helps to solve dermatological disorders such as psoriasis, eczema, irritations and stimulates skin regeneration.
Mix 2-3 tablespoons with warm water until you obtain a smooth mixture and leave to rest for 15/20 minutes.
Apply the mixture, also combined with other herbs or clays, as a mask on the face and leave on for up to 15 minutes. Rinse with warm water.
